Warehouse Pest Control Pricing in March Air Reserve Base

When it comes to warehouse pest control services in March Air Reserve Base, Lloyd Pest Control offers comprehensive pricing options to suit different needs and budgets. The average cost for a maintenance service visit is $218, ensuring effective and regular pest management. For pest control specifically targeting warehouses in March Air Reserve Base, the cost generally falls between $100 and $450 per visit, with the price varying based on the contract’s frequency. Additionally, Lloyd Pest Control provides annual service contracts for warehouses, with prices ranging from $400 to $1,800 per year. The total cost is influenced by the project’s size and the specific type of pest services required, allowing each customer to receive a tailored solution that fits their unique needs.

Warehouse owners at March Air Reserve Base face specific pest pressures that come from high-volume shipping, expansive storage racking, and frequent truck traffic. Proximity to greenbelts and occasional agricultural sites increases the risk of rodents, birds, and stored-product pests entering loading docks and palletized goods, while climate-driven cockroach and ant activity can threaten sanitary conditions and inventory integrity. Lloyd Pest Control offers proactive, professional pest management for warehouses—combining integrated pest management, regular inspections, exclusion work, and targeted treatments—to protect inventory, maintain compliance, and preserve business continuity with eco-friendly options and a 100% Money-Back Guarantee.

Key Climate And Environmental Conditions That Influence Pest Activity In March Air Reserve Base:

  • Warm, mild climate year-round that supports continuous breeding cycles for rodents, ants, and cockroaches
  • Seasonal rainfall and irrigation that create pockets of moisture near docks and landscaping, attracting insects and mosquitoes
  • Nearby agricultural and greenbelt areas that serve as reservoirs for rodents, birds, and stored-product insects
  • High-volume shipping, container storage, and frequent door openings that increase pest entry points and cross-contamination risk

Cost of March Air Reserve Base Pest Control for Warehouses by Type of Pest

Type of Pest Average Per-Visit Cost* Avg Monthly Cost Average Annual Contract Number of Projects
Termite $218 $73 $871/year 7
Spider $175 $58 $700/year 5
Ant $194 $65 $775/year 4
Roach $194 $65 $775/year 4
Mouse $225 $75 $900/year 3
Rat $225 $75 $900/year 3
